Department of Dermatology
Department of Dermatology at University Hospital Erlangen provides conservative and surgical care for patients with skin diseases. The department is internationally recognized as a Center of High Competence and it directs a special focus towards the treatment of inflammatory skin diseases and tumors. The department has a Skin Cancer Center that is working in close cooperation with the center of gravity for tumor therapy in the region of North Bavaria.
The department has 46 beds where over 2,200 inpatients and 1,400 semi-patients are treated every year under the guidance of Prof. Dr. Med. Gerold Schuler. The department also offers its service on an outpatient basis where it provides care for over 50,000 outpatients annually. The research unit of the department has about 182 workers, of which there are 39 doctors and 23 scientists. The main research projects are the biology of dendritic cells and vaccine development.
The Department of Dermatology at University Hospital Erlangen is specialized in the diagnosis and treatment of:
• Malignant melanoma
• Allergies
• Vitiligo
• Psoriasis
• Eczema
• Erectile dysfunction
Academic and Professional Career
- 1969 - 1975 Study of Medicine at the University of Innsbruck, Austria.
- 1975 - 1977 Work at the Institute of Histology and Embryology, University of Innsbruck, Austria.
- 1977 - 1983 Medical Specialist training for skin and venereal diseases, University Hospital Innsbruck, Austria.
- 1983 - 1985 Research Fellow at the Rockefeller University, New York, USA.
- 1984 Habilitation.
- 1993 Associate Professor and Head of the Department of Experimental Dermatology of the University Hospital Innsbruck, Austria.
- Since 1995 Head of the Department of Dermatology at the University Hospital Erlangen.
Project Coordination, Membership in Joint Projects
- 1997 - 2002 German Research Foundation Project "Immune Tolerance Induction by Dendritic Cells".
- 2004 - 2016 Spokesman of the German Research Foundation Collaborative Research Center 654 "Strategies of the cellular immunotherapy".
Awards and Honorary Memberships
- 1983 Fellow of the Max Kade Foundation.
- Since 1998 Corresponding Member of the Austrian Academy of Sciences.
- 2006 German Cancer Award.
- Since 2010 Member of the National Academy of Sciences Leopoldina.
